WebFeb 17, 2024 · ALAMO, Texas — A rare bird of prey was spotted in southern Texas in late December, marking the first time it had been seen in the U.S. >> Read more trending news. The bat falcon is commonly seen in Mexico and Central America, but it was the first time it had been seen north of those areas, KSAT-TV reported. WebApr 12, 2024 · Types of Red Birds in Texas. 1. Summer Tanager. The size of a summer tanager is comparable to that of a common cardinal. The summer tanager is a species of the cardinal family despite its name and former classification as a “tanager” (Cardinalidae). Like other cardinals, it has distinctive feathers and a distinctive call.
